Title of article :
Effect of Co substitution on the magnetic and transport properties of the half-metallic ferrimagnet Mn2VGa

Abstract :
Mn 2 − x Co x V Ga ( x = 0.5 , 0.75 and 1) compounds were synthesized by arc melting to investigate the effect of cobalt substitution on the magnetic and transport properties of the half-metallic ferrimagnetic compound Mn2VGa. The lattice parameter value decreases with the substitution of Co. The compounds Mn1.25Co0.75VGa and MnCoVGa showed a substantial reduction in magnetic moment due to anti-parallel alignment of the Mn moment with Co and V moments and the M z value for these compounds observed to be 0.35 μ B and 0.37 μ B respectively. The magnetic moment per formula unit at 5 K, estimated from magnetization data, indicates a slight deviation from the Slater–Pauling relation. The Curie temperature was found to decrease with the Co substitution. Low temperature resistivity data in the temperature range of 18–100 K was observed to follow the relation ρ = ρ 0 + A T 2 + B T 4.5
